Core Features of Modern Trackers

Portfolio trackers typically offer several core features that lay the foundation for efficient management:

  • Automated Exchange Integration: Seamless direct connections (via APIs) with major exchanges such as Binance, Coinbase, Kraken, and KuCoin, enabling real-time balance and transaction updates.
  • Wallet Address Monitoring: The ability to link and monitor multiple blockchain addresses across various networks, supporting both hot and cold storage solutions.
  • DeFi Protocol Integration: Connectivity with protocols like Aave, Uniswap, Curve, and Compound, allowing you to track DeFi exposure and yields.
  • Performance Analytics: Metric-rich dashboards displaying profit and loss calculations, return on investment (ROI) tracking, and asset distribution breakdowns.

A significant technical leap is the use of WebSocket connections for real-time data streaming. By enabling instantaneous updates without manual refreshing, this advancement has reduced latency by up to 80 percent compared to conventional REST APIs. Portfolio tracking is now more responsive and reliable.

Security Implementation Standards

Security remains a top priority for portfolio trackers, recognizing the high-value and sensitive nature of user data:

  1. API Key Management: Use of read-only API keys, often with IP whitelisting, to ensure that your funds can never be moved by portfolio apps.
  2. Encryption Protocols: Employment of AES-256 encryption for data at rest and TLS 1.3 for all data in transit, securing information both on your devices and during transmission.
  3. Multi-Factor Authentication (MFA): Support for multiple forms of MFA, including app-based authenticators and hardware security keys like YubiKey, to add an extra layer of defense.
  4. Zero-Knowledge Architecture: Advanced platforms avoid storing private keys or sensitive secrets, keeping you firmly in control of your credentials.

These standards have become increasingly important as users demand enterprise-grade protection similar to that found in major traditional finance platforms.

Advanced Portfolio Tracking Capabilities

As crypto investment strategies become more complex, portfolio trackers have introduced advanced features to help users stay ahead.

Cross-Chain Monitoring Systems

Handling crypto assets spread across multiple blockchains is a significant technical challenge. Leading trackers now deploy blockchain indexers and custom APIs to aggregate holdings, activity, and yields in one place for a holistic portfolio view.

  • Network Coverage: Advanced trackers now support 30 or more major blockchain networks, including Ethereum, Binance Smart Chain, Solana, Avalanche, and Polygon.
  • Cross-Chain Transactions: Capable of monitoring not only balances but also tracking bridge transactions and swaps across chains, giving you complete transparency.
  • Protocol Integration: Connectivity with over 200 DeFi protocols, easing the tracking of positions, rewards, and risks across different ecosystems.
  • Gas Fee Analytics: Insights into transaction fees across supported networks, assisting users in optimizing operational costs and maximizing returns.

This level of coverage ensures that diversified investors have full transparency over multi-chain activity. It’s practically a necessity these days, thanks to the rise of cross-chain bridges, Layer-2 solutions, and expanding blockchain ecosystems.

DeFi Position Tracking

DeFi investing adds unique layers of complexity, and modern trackers have responded with targeted features.

  1. Liquidity Pool Monitoring
  • Real-time calculations of impermanent loss to help assess risks and true returns.
  • APY (Annual Percentage Yield) and APR (Annual Percentage Rate) tracking across key protocols.
  • Clear valuation of positions in both USD and native tokens.
  1. Yield Farming Analytics
  • Aggregated and compound yield calculation, considering both base rates and additional protocol incentives.
  • Automated reward token tracking and conversion histories.
  • Historical yield performance to measure strategy effectiveness over time.
  1. Staking Position Management
  • Monitoring of delegated staking positions and validator addresses.
  • Reward and payout tracking, including anticipated future yields and scheduled events.
  • Alerts for unbonding periods, ensuring you never miss key timelines.

By automating these processes, trackers save DeFi participants countless manual steps and enable deeper, data-driven decision-making.

Comparative Analysis of Leading Trackers

Feature Comparison Matrix

Not all portfolio trackers are created equal. There is a marked distinction between basic and advanced solutions.

Basic Tier Applications:

  • Connect to 5–10 major exchanges with limited blockchain network support (typically 3–5).
  • Offer basic price threshold alerts and straightforward asset overviews.
  • Cost is generally free, though advanced features are restricted or absent.

Advanced Platforms:

  • Integrate with 30 or more exchanges and 20 or more networks (including Layer-1, Layer-2, and sidechains).
  • Support DeFi positions across 100+ protocols for wide-ranging coverage.
  • Deliver sophisticated analytics, custom reporting, and in-depth historical insights.
  • Subscription costs usually range from $10–50 per month, with varying pricing based on features and portfolio size.

This diversity allows investors (from casual beginners to professional traders) to choose software that fits their current needs and scales with their evolving strategies.

Integration Capabilities

A platform’s integration options and depth significantly affect usability and coverage.

  1. Exchange Integration Depth
  • Leading trackers support full order history, spot, and derivative markets for major platforms such as Binance, Coinbase, and Kraken.
  • Decentralized exchange (DEX) support includes activity on Uniswap, PancakeSwap, and SushiSwap.
  • Tracking extends to NFTs and marketplace activity for comprehensive asset visibility.
  1. Wallet Compatibility
  • Support extends to hardware wallets like Ledger and Trezor, as well as popular software wallets such as MetaMask, Trust Wallet, and Exodus.
  • Multi-signature wallet compatibility (for instance, Gnosis Safe) is increasingly available, meeting the needs of DAO treasuries and high-security users.

This array of integrations makes it possible for investors to consolidate even complex, fragmented portfolios.

Automated Tax Calculation Systems

Advanced tracking solutions deliver purpose-built tax reporting capabilities, including:

  • Transaction Classification: Automatic categorization of trades, staking rewards, mining proceeds, and airdrops.
  • Cost Basis Tracking: Support for various cost basis methodologies such as FIFO (First-In, First-Out), LIFO (Last-In, First-Out), and average cost.
  • Tax Form Generation: Direct export to country-specific tax forms, including the United States’ Form 8949 and other relevant documentation.
  • Multi-Jurisdiction Support: Global capability, including tailored calculations for more than 20 countries and regions, accommodating a wide range of tax laws and standards.

Integration with Tax Software

To further streamline filing, leading trackers integrate directly with accounting and tax preparation software:

  • TurboTax
  • H&R Block
  • TaxAct
  • Professional applications like QuickBooks or Xero

These integrations enable seamless data exports and reduce manual entry errors by up to 90 percent, according to studies from major tax software firms. This feature is not only a time saver for individual investors, but also essential for tax professionals managing crypto portfolios on behalf of clients.

In addition to simplifying annual filings, these systems help ensure year-round compliance, avoiding common pitfalls that can otherwise result in costly mistakes or penalties.
